The OBX headers are based on the old Dynatech design. Therefore they have the goofy up and over primary tube on the driver side that makes routing and protecting your spark plug wires a chore. Other than that, and the crazy rate of heat exchange of stainless steel (or so I've read), they seem to be decent headers for the money.
